USS CONSTELLATION RETURNS HOME — Sailors and marines onboard USS Constellation man the rails and show their appreciation as friends and family show their support and greet the Constellation and crew as they return to their homeport at Naval Air Station North Island, San Diego, Calif., June 2. Constellation returned following a seven-month deployment to the Arabian Gulf in support of Operations Enduring and Iraqi Freedom. During Operation Iraqi Freedom, the Constellation Carrier Strike Group flew more than 1,500 sorties. U.S. Navy photo by Photographer's Mate 1st Class Ted Banks
